The Artistry Behind Black and Grey Tattoos

Creating a flawless black and grey tattoo requires a deep understanding of shading, depth, and texture. The best black and grey tattoo artists are not just experts in using ink but also in creating three-dimensional effects that make the tattoo look lifelike. They carefully blend different tones, from solid blacks to lighter greys, to create contrast and achieve a smooth gradient effect. Unlike colorful tattoos, black and grey work depends solely on technical skills and artistic vision, making the choice of an artist even more important.

Characteristics of a Top Black and Grey Tattoo Artist

Not every tattoo artist specializes in black and grey tattoos. The best black and grey tattoo artist artists have a few key characteristics that set them apart from others. First, they have a solid understanding of shading techniques and know how to use different needle sizes to create soft or bold lines. Second, they have an eye for detail and can capture fine textures, such as skin wrinkles, hair strands, and shadows. Lastly, they have an impressive portfolio showcasing realistic portraits, intricate patterns, and breathtaking compositions. If an artist possesses these qualities, they are likely to be one of the best in the field.

How to Prepare for a Black and Grey Tattoo Session

Once you have found the best black and grey tattoo artist  proper preparation is key to getting the best tattoo experience. Before your appointment, ensure you are well-rested, hydrated, and have eaten a proper meal. Avoid alcohol or blood-thinning medications, as they can cause excessive bleeding. Wear comfortable clothing that allows easy access to the tattoo area. Discuss the design with your artist beforehand and ensure you are both on the same page regarding placement, size, and detailing. A well-prepared client helps the artist work efficiently and achieve the best possible results.

Black and Grey Tattoo Aftercare Tips

Proper aftercare is essential to maintaining the beauty and longevity of your best black  and grey tattoo artist. Keep the tattoo clean by washing it gently with antibacterial soap and lukewarm water. Apply a thin layer of tattoo-friendly moisturizer to keep the skin hydrated. Avoid direct sunlight, swimming, and excessive sweating for the first few weeks. Refrain from picking or scratching the tattoo as it heals to prevent scarring and fading. Following these aftercare instructions ensures that your tattoo heals properly and remains sharp for years to come.

FAQs

Q1: How do I know if a black and grey tattoo artist is good?
A great black and grey tattoo artist has a strong portfolio showcasing detailed shading, smooth gradients, and realistic designs. Checking reviews and client testimonials can also help verify their reputation.

Q2: How long do black and grey tattoos last?
Black and grey tattoos tend to age well compared to colored tattoos, as they don’t fade as quickly. Proper aftercare and sun protection can help maintain their quality for decades.

Q3: Are black and grey tattoos more painful than colored tattoos?
The pain level of a tattoo depends on the placement and individual pain tolerance rather than the ink color. However, black and grey tattoos often involve shading techniques that may feel different from color tattooing.
